What to Expect in Brazil in January
The weather in Brazil in January can be quite varied, with temperatures that range from warm to very hot and precipitation levels ranging from moderate to heavy.
Temperatures
The average highest temperatures fluctuate between warm in São Joaquim national park at 25°C (77°F) to very hot in Piranhas at 35°C (95°F). Nighttime temperatures generally drop to 24°C (75°F) in Piranhas and 15°C (59°F) in São Joaquim national park. The temperatures cited for both day and night represent usual averages, but it's possible some days could be hotter. Precipitation
In January, precipitation varies across different areas. From moderate rainfall in Boa Vista with an average of 38 mm (1.5 in) to heavy rainfall in Paraty with 510 mm (20 in). Based on our climate, it is the month with the most precipitation throughout the year in Rio de Janeiro.Average sunshine
January brings good sunshine to many areas. Rio de Janeiro sees around 212 hours of sunlight, great for visitors looking for bright days.
